Picking a Bug Control Company

If you have a problem with unwanted pests in your home, and you've tired all the self-help solutions you understand, you may be considering working with a commercial insect control company to deal with the issue. Working with an expert may be exactly the right option for you; however you require to do your homework. First, how do you locate a business? Examining the yellow pages of your regional telephone directory might be a great start; doing a keyword search on the Internet for your area might likewise work, and you have the added benefit of seeing what info the business provides, on itself and on insect control generally. Ask pals and coworkers for suggestions After you've established a list of insect control services, and prior to you call these business, begin asking more concerns of your colleagues and buddies. Did the business in concern resolve their bug infestation concerns? Any problems in the home after the business performed their services? Once you've limited your list to a couple of potential providers, call them on the phone, and ask some more concerns: does the company provide a complimentary home evaluation and estimate of expenses? Does it offer you advice on what you can do to deal with the problem yourself? Is the business willing to answer concerns readily? Specific concerns to ask: what kinds of chemicals are used? Do your household and family animals require to vacate the facilities during the bug control treatment? Make certain you ask whether the business provides nontoxic, natural insect control. The company ought to be willing to a minimum of discuss the alternatives; if its representative simply dismisses the notion of nontoxic bug control without smartly going over the advantages and disadvantages of the natural solutions readily available, but just wishes to enter into your home and spray, beware! With composed info (or your own notes) in hand, do your own research study on any chemicals that will be used - their efficiency, their possible negative effects, their potential toxicity. (The Internet is a great location to begin for this.) If you have member of the family with severe health concerns, particularly asthma or other respiratory ailments, make certain you understand what the prospective effect of sprayed substances could have on them. If you have any concerns about the company's dependability, and you can't find anybody you understand and whose judgment you rely on to vouch for them, call your regional or state Better Business Bureau or Consumer Fraud Division, to find out whether there have been any complaints lodged against them. Make sure you understand who is going to be revealing up at your house and when when you've hired a company. Make certain they have appropriate I.D., and ask if you can be there to supervise the process or if you need to leave, and for how long. And while you've got access to the professional treating your home, ask what you can do to prevent pest control problems in the future, especially those including destructive carpenter ants and termites. The person (or gal) who really does the work most likely has insights into the subject that the workplace staff doesn't have. Control Vermin From Breaking Into Your Gardens And Spoil Your Gardening Spirit!

Undesirable insects in your garden are simply that: undesirable. Organic gardening is a way of managing undesirable bugs naturally, without the usage of hazardous pesticides. Secure your natural soil and useful bugs While pesticides may get rid of the bug, they most frequently trigger more harm than good. Many home and industrial garden enthusiasts are uninformed of options to pesticides. damaging the soil and being a health danger to individuals-- including our kids-- pesticides present a major problem. They eliminate types indiscriminately, causing practical garden co-habitants to vanish along with the hazardous ones. An organic garden with helpful bugs The fact remains that not all bugs are unwanted pests. More than simply excellent luck, ladybugs are an extremely handy natural pesticide to have in your garden, feeding on a myriad of insect undesirable insects consisting of aphids if you ever see little alligator like pests around your garden, leave them be! Undoubtedly, s are not as intelligent as your average kindergartner-- they kill bugs on a wholesale level while distressing environments and ruining your plants as well as your soil. Are your garden pests resistant to pesticides? Over the years the unwanted pests become resistant to the pesticides and significantly bigger quantities must be utilized. The outcome is a coated crop and a pesticide resistant bug, a crop that is more susceptible to the insect pest. Are you hurting the local bird population? The bird is targeted as well because the pesticide is an indiscriminate toxin. If the birds do not instantly vanish, their eggshells end up being thinner and thinner and often break when moms and dad birds sit on the eggs. This is a big issue with bald eagles in North America. Without any insects and no birds those predators which live off of the birds disappear too, causing a huge interruption in the regional community which is never useful to growth of any kind. Birds consume insects! Motivate birds to come into your garden by placing a bird bath in the garden and by planting plants that will draw in birds such as sunflowers. There are even perennial sunflowers that not only attract birds all year but, can likewise be planted like a hedge and drive away deer and other animals. Helianthus maximillani. Natural bug control is rooted in an energetic, balanced environment. Years of pesticide usage may be so disruptive to a local community that the land might end up being unusable after just a few years. They stay in the soil and become more concentrated with each year of use, ultimately rendering the soil unable to produce vigorous plants. The soil can heal There is hope. Some items like methyl bromide can be modified by merely adding raw material to the contaminated soil. The result is addition of the organic portion of this pesticide to the raw material that you already added and freedom of the bromide ion. At the minimum, you can include organic matter to a packed soil to merely water down the concentration. Nevertheless, you can likewise search for the MSDS online for that to learn how to amend it. Organic alternatives to pesticides There are many natural, natural options to pesticides that are more long lasting, safe, usually effective and energetic. One of the most basic bug control gadgets is a barrier. By covering a row of crop with a light netting (which permits the sunshine to come through) flying undesirable bugs are successfully kept away from the plants. simple method of insect control for a small garden is handpicking. Numerous slugs and Hornworms can be handpicked off of plants with great success. Drop unwanted bugs into a meal of soapy water to eliminate them. Particular moths and bugs can be knocked out of trees with a stick; permit them to fall onto a big piece of fabric so that they can be gathered and, later on, submerged in a soapy service or incinerated. Beneficial Insects Will Control the Bad Insects Some pests like the Ladybug and the Green Lacewing are called helpful due to the fact that they are the heros who are on the hunt for the bad men that are eating your plants. Here is a list of beneficial insects, with links to where they are provided by an Earth friendly distributor. Green Lacewings Chrysoperla carnea Green Lacewings are an all function advantageous insect that feed on pests such as aphids and other pests that will feed and come on your plants. Green Lacewings are ideal for a backyard garden, larger garden, or a greenhouse. Easy way to eliminate aphids and slugs! Likewise, some plants themselves are pesticides. For instance, planting tobacco around your vegetable garden is an excellent way to prevent slugs and aphids!
